REVOCABLE ENCROACHMENT AGREEMENT
This agreement is between the City of Oshkosh ("City"), and Jeffrey J. Marsh
("Owner"). The parties enter into this agreement for$1.00 and other good and valuable
consideration, the receipt of which is acknowledged.
The Owner is the fee owner of the property commonly known as 423 North Main
Street("Property"), and with a summary description as follows:
The South %2 of Lot Four (4) of Block Forty-Four (44), in the Seventh
Ward, City of Oshkosh, Winnebago County, Wisconsin, per Leach's
Map of 1894.
Adjoining the Property along its East boundary Is a public right-of-way used for
various public utilities, public sidewalks, end a public vehicular way commonly known as
Main Street. The City currently owns and/or is responsible for maintenance of the right of
way for this section of Main Street and therefore has the authority to enter into this
agreement.
The Owner desires to erect an awning (Projecting Awning), to be attached to the
Owner's building on the Property and will project over and extend into the right of way no
more than three feet four Inches (3' 4") from the face of the building. No structure or
object, including the proposed awning, is allowed to project into a right of way without the
City's permission.
The City of Oshkosh has reviewed the Owner's request as described in this
document,and will allow the placement of the requested Projecting Awning subject to the
terms and conditions identified In this agreement. Both parties agree that all of the City's
terms and conditions in this document are to be considered material. Specific terms and
conditions of this agreement between City and Owner follow.
1. The City grants permission to the Owner to attach an awning to the building on
his Property which will project into the right-of-way of Main Street, provided that
the Projecting Awning Is materially similar to the Awning design and
specifications submitted for the City's approval. All parts of or related to the
Awning shall have a minimum sidewalk clearance of eight(8)feet, or distance
otherwise required by code or City policy. A drawing of the Projecting Awning
allowed Is attached hereto as Exhibit A.
2. The City's permission for this Projecting Awning is contingent upon the initial,
and continuing, compliance with all applicable local, state, and federal codes
and rules. The Projecting Awning shall comply with City Ordinances, including
but not limited to requirements for permits, structures, signs, projecting signs,
Chapter 30-37 and Chapter 30-27.
3. The Owner agrees that he is solely responsible for the installation and
maintenance of the Projecting Awning, and that he is solely responsible for any
and all personal or property damage caused by the Projecting Awning.
4.. The Owner is solely responsible for securing, maintaining, repairing, and
replacing the Projecting Awning. The City's permission and approval of each of

the Projecting Awning is not related to the Owner's responsibility for the short
and long term stability and safety of the Projecting Awning,
5. The Owner acknowledges and agrees that public utilities and facilities, and the
street and sidewalk, in the right-of-way are subject to maintenance, repair or
replacement. In the event that maintenance, repair, or replacement of public
utilities or facilities in the right-of-way will need to occur, the City agrees to make
reasonable efforts to notify the Owner of these activities so that the Owner may
remove or otherwise protect the Projecting Awning if affected. If the Owner
elects to remove or otherwise protect the Projecting Awning, such actions must
be taken within the timeframe for the City's anticipated work. However, the City
shall not be responsible for any damage to the Projecting Awning, or any
structure or hardware to which the Projecting Awning Is attached, related to the
City's actions in its right of way. The City has no obligation, but shall be allowed
to remove, at its sole discretion, the Projecting Awning for the purpose of
maintenance, repairs, and replacement of utilities and facilities within the right of
way. The Owner shall be responsible for reinstalling/reattaching the Projecting
Awning in those circumstances where the City removes the Projecting Awning.
The City shall be reimbursed by the Owner for all costs and expenses related to
removing or protecting the Projecting Awning. The Owner gives the City
permission to enter, access, and alter his Property that is not in the right of way
for the sole purpose of removing or protecting the Projecting Awning.
6. The City is allowed to revoke its permission for the Projecting Awning for any of
the following reasons:
a. The City's use of the right of way prohibits the continued location of the
Projecting Awning;
b. The Projecting Awning Interferes with or may potentially damage
landscaping and/or other streetscape improvements;
c. Local, state, or federal rules, laws, or guidelines relating to public
sidewalk or street clearances or distances prohibit the continued location
of the Projecting Awning;
d. The Owner fails to property maintain, repair, or replace the Projecting
Awning;
e. The Owner fails to provide the City with annual written proof that the
Projecting Awning is covered by the required Insurance.
7. The Owner releases the City of Oshkosh, its employees, agents, elected
officials, and authorized volunteers from all debt, claims, demands, damages,
actions and causes of action whatsoever which may result from the Projecting
Awnings. The Owner shall protect, hold harmless, and Indemnify the City of
Oshkosh against all actions, claims and demands of any kind or character
whatsoever which are related to the Projecting Awning.
8. Both parties understand and agree that accidents and incidents occurring on
City rights of way may result in lawsuits or threats of lawsuits against the City.
Therefore, the Owner agrees to indemnify and pay to the City all amounts that
the City may be required, obligated, or adjudged as responsible to pay, for any
dispute or action related to the Projecting Awning. This Indemnification is broad,
and shall Include damages, attorney's fees and costs, and defense costs, The
payments required of the Owner by this paragraph are due no later than 30 days

after written request for such indemnification. The Owner agrees that this
paragraph shall be liberally construed in favor of the City of Oshkosh, in
consideration of the privilege granted by the City under this agreement.
9. At all times during which the Projecting Awning encroaches Into the right of way,
the Owner's property liability Insurance shall cover all potential liabilities related
to the Projecting Awning. The Owner's insurance shall provide reasonable
coverage for potential damages to persons and property caused wholly, or In
part, by the Projecting Awning, Minimum Insurance coverage related to the
Projecting Awning shall be $500,000 for each occurrence for bodily injury and
property damage liability and $500,000 general aggregate. The Owner's
insurance shall include the City of Oshkosh as an additional insured on its policy
for claims, liabilities, and damages related to the Projecting Awning, The owner's
insurance shall provide primary coverage and that any insurance or self
insurance maintained by the City of Oshkosh, its officers, council members,
agents, employees or authorized volunteers will not contribute to a loss. The
Owner shall annually provide the City with proof of insurance for the Projecting
Awning.
10. The City's permission is personal to the Owner, is not Intended to convey any
property rights, and cannot be transferred or assigned to any other person or
entity, whether voluntarily or involuntarily. The Owner's rights contained In this
agreement do not attach to property and do not run with the land. Permission
for the Projecting Awnings is revoked immediately and without notice as of the
time that any person or entity other than the"Owner"identified In this document
becomes a fee owner, whether in whole or in part, of the property at 423 North
Main Street. Revocation of permission for the Projecting Awning will also occur
where the Owner forms an entity of which he Is the sole or partial owner.
11, The Owner's responsibilities pursuant to this agreement extend to other
persons, contractors,and agents performing work on Owner's behalf and related
to the Projecting Awning.
12. This agreement is solely for the benefit of the parties to this agreement, and it is
not intended to benefit any third party.
13, The election to enforce or not enforce any term of this agreement, or any
statute, code, or rule, as well as the timing of such enforcement, shall be at the
City's sole discretion and shall not act as a waiver of any rights to exercise any
right relating to the Projecting Awning in the future.
14. This agreement shall Incorporate all immunities and limitations provided to
municipalities within the Wisconsin Statutes, regardless of whether a claim is -
based upon contract, tort, or other theory.
This agreement shall riot run with the land.
•
This agreement shall become effective upon the last date a party signs below.
